What a great year for BMG-Zomba. They took home a slew of awards at last month's ASCAP and BMI Pop Awards. Both performing rights societies honored the most performed songs of 2004. They also represent six nominations at the BET Awards, which honor the best in urban and gospel music. The 2005 BET Awards will air live from Hollywood on June 28.

"Winning these ASCAP and BMI awards cap off a remarkable 2004, the best year in BMG Music Publishing's history," said Nicholas Firth (Chairman, BMG Music Publishing Worldwide). "More than ever, 2004 showed remarkable diversity at pop radio-- from pop and rock to hip-hop and country songs -- and we are proud to represent the year's biggest hits in each of these genres."

About BMG-Zomba

Established in 1987, BMG Music Publishing, a unit of Bertelsmann AG, is the world’s largest independent music publisher and the world's third largest music publisher among all music publishers. BMG is also the number one publisher of classical music and Contemporary Christian music and is the global leader in production music. The company is headquartered in New York and has wholly-owned offices in 31 countries.
